CVE-2021-4123Network attack vector

Authenticated state changes via forged cross-site requests

Published Dec 16, 2021 · Updated Aug 3, 2024

Cross-site request forgery in Live Helper Chat before 2.0 allows remote authenticated users to alter application state via crafted requests. The affected settings and operator-status handlers accepted state-changing GET requests, while the patch converts those calls to POST and activates the application's CSRF protection routine. An authenticated session is required to process a forged request; public sources do not identify a single triggering endpoint or describe a consequence beyond the CNA's availability-only assessment.
